Delhi Court grants divorce to Yo Yo Honey Singh from wife Shalini Talwar after 11 years of marriage: Report

Trigger Warning: This article includes references to domestic violence 

In a significant development, a Delhi court has granted divorce to singer-rapper Honey Singh and his wife, Shalini Talwar, after an almost 11-year marriage. Principal Judge of the Family Court, Paramjit Singh, approved the second motion in this case, concluding a nearly two-and-a-half-year legal process.

Delhi Court officially grants Honey Singh divorce from Shalini Talwar

On November 7, the Delhi court finalized the divorce of renowned singer Yo Yo Honey Singh and his wife, Shalini Talwar, marking the end of their nearly 11-year-long marriage.

During the court hearing today, the judge inquired whether Singh had any intentions of attempting reconciliation and resuming life with his wife. To this, Singh responded unequivocally, stating that there was no chance of them reuniting.

The Principal Judge of the Family Court, Paramjit Singh, issued the divorce decree following a mutual settlement agreement that effectively resolved all their disputes. Notably, this included a domestic violence case that Shalini Talwar had lodged against the singer and his family. Subsequent to the settlement, Singh’s wife withdrew the domestic violence case, which had accused him and his family of aggressive conduct. Furthermore, she had alleged that the singer had a history of employing criminal intimidation and brutal violence against those who opposed his demands.

‘I love him so so much’: Ira Khan drops new PICS from pre-wedding festivities with fiancé Nupur Shikhare

Aamir Khan’s daughter Ira Khan and Nupur Shikhare officially got engaged in November last year. The couple is getting ready for their wedding in early 2024. Ira and her fiancé have already kickstarted the pre-wedding festivities as they performed Kelvan a few days ago. Today, November 7, she posted a bunch of pictures from the second set of Kelvan and Ukhana alongwith a beautiful message. 

Ira Khan and fiancé Nupur Shikhare hug each other in new pre-wedding festivities pictures 

A while ago, Ira Khan dropped a bunch of photos from the second set of Kelvan and Ukhana as she began her pre-wedding festivities with fiancé Nupur Shikhare

In the pictures, the couple can be seen hugging each other while flaunting their bright smiles. One of the snaps shows Ira tying a flower band to Nupur’s wrist. She also shared a video where the duo can be seen engaged in a funny conversation while having food as pet of the ritual. 

For the occasion, Ira wore a red saree and accessorized it with flower jewelry. On the other hand, Nupur wore a yellow kurta and white pants.

Sharing the pictures, Ira wrote, “Kelvan 2! Ukhana 2! I love him so so much.” Take a look: 

In a conversation with News18 India, Aamir Khan earlier revealed that Ira Khan will marry Nupur Shikhare on January 3, 2024. Aamir praised Nupur and said that he was already like a son to him. “Ira is getting married on January 3. The boy she has chosen is — waise toh pet name unka naam Popeye hai (by the way, his pet name is Popeye the sailor man) — he is a trainer, he has arms like Popeye but his name is Nupur. He is a lovely boy,” added Aamir. 

Meanwhile, Ira is Aamir Khan and his former wife Reena Dutta’s daughter. According to reports, Ira and Nupur started dating in 2020 and they made their relationship Insta-official in 2021.
